What affects the price

Wildlife removal costs aren't one-size-fits-all because every property is different. The final bill depends on the type of animal you’re dealing with, how long they’ve been inside, and the specific entry points they’ve chewed through. If the critter has created a nest in a hard-to-reach attic or caused structural damage, repairs will naturally increase the labor required. We also consider the complexity of the trapping plan and the number of follow-up visits needed to ensure the problem stays solved.

Summer heat drives animals to look for cool, shaded areas, which often leads them into garages, sheds, or under decks. This is also when young animals start venturing out on their own, leading to more frequent sightings and property interactions. What is the 3-3-3 rule for rehoming dogs?

The 3-3-3 rule is a common guideline for understanding a dog's adjustment period in a new home: 3 days to decompress, 3 weeks to learn routines, and 3 months to feel secure. While our focus is wildlife, understanding animal behavior is key to humane practices.
